Dear Friends,

I would to ask if anyone here would be interested in playing Napoleonic / 18th-19th Century era Games ?

I would be willing to work on this if there is interest, by organizing a seminar on rules and miniature collection / building. We could look at both commercial games / miniatures, and free rules / paper minis from the internet, then play a demonstration game. There are many free rules in the internet. I'd suggest though we go with the classic HG Wells rules "Little Wars"

If there is very serious interest, I am willing to dust off my Prince August and Meisterzinn 54mm/40mm moulds and produce lead miniatures, and provide them to players at "friendship" prices !

I am currently based abroad, but will be back home January 2013. If there is interest we could discuss this first in the board, then have our seminar then.
